Cauliflower Soup Recipe
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: 4 1x
Description
Creamy Cauliflower Soup delivers comfort in a bowl, blending roasted cauliflower with silky broth and subtle herbs. Rich, velvety textures and delicate flavor notes invite hearty spoonfuls that warm souls and delight senses.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ients:
- 1 large head cauliflower (about 2 pounds)
- 1 (32-ounce / 946 milliliters) box low-sodium vegetable or chicken broth
- 1 medium yellow onion
- 2 cloves garlic
Seasoning Ingredients:
- 4 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 teaspoons kosher salt
- 0.5 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
Garnish/Flavor Enhancers:
- 1 small bunch fresh thyme
- 0.5 small lemon
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F (218°C) and position the rack in the center of the cooking space.
- Transform whole cauliflower into uniform 1-inch (2.5-centimeter) florets, ensuring consistent sizing for even roasting.
- Generously coat cauliflower pieces with extra virgin olive oil, then season with k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per.
- Spread seasoned cauliflower on a rimmed baking sheet in a single layer, allowing each piece maximum exposure to heat.
- Roast cauliflower for 20-25 minutes, rotating the pan midway to achieve golden-brown caramelization and enhance natural sweetness.
- While cauliflower roasts, finely dice yellow onion and mince fresh garlic cloves for aromatic base.
- Heat additional olive oil in a large soup pot, gently sautéing onion and garlic until translucent and fragrant.
- Transfer roasted cauliflower to the pot, reserving several attractive florets for garnish.
- Pour vegetable or chicken broth into the pot, adding fresh thyme leaves and additional seasoning.
- Bring mixture to a gentle boil, then reduce heat and simmer covered for 15 minutes to meld flavors.
- Remove pot from heat and squeeze fresh lemon juice for brightness.
- Use an immersion blender or standard blender to puree soup until silky and smooth.
- Taste and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.
- Ladle soup into serving bowls, garnishing with reserved roasted cauliflower florets and delicate thyme leaves.
Notes
- Roast cauliflower transforms this soup from ordinary to extraordinary, creating deep caramelized flavors that intensify the overall taste profile.
- Blending techniques matter significantly, ensuring a silky smooth texture without unwanted chunks or grainy consistency.
- Fresh thyme and lemon juice provide bright, herbaceous notes that lift the soup’s earthy undertones and create balanced complexity.
- Reserving roasted florets allows for a beautiful garnish that adds visual appeal and textural contrast to the creamy soup.
- Seasoning adjustment at the end ensures each serving tastes perfectly balanced and deliciously personalized.
